How do you write a letter requesting a future job opening?

A letter requesting a future job opening should always be written to a specific person, such as the hiring manager or director of the Human Resources department. If you’re not sure who to address it to, call the company. Address the letter with a friendly salutation and the person’s formal title, such as “Dear Ms.

How do you write a formal letter request?

A letter of request is written like a business letter as it is a formal letter. The letter should have your name, position, title, address and contact information. The letter should address the recipient clearly and properly. Stay polite and to the point.

What’s the purpose of a job request letter?

A job request letter is written to apply for an advertised or non-advertised position. It is an opportunity for interested candidates to showcase their qualifications.

What does a job request letter for fresher mean?

The job request/application letter for fresher is a formal letter, which can assist a fresher landing on a suitable job. It is written with the intention to capture the attention of the employer.
